Sri Lanka Army Para Games 2010:

Infantry Regiment emerge champions

Sri Lanka Infantry Regiment emerged champions at the Sri Lanka Army Para Games 2010 concluded at the Army Ground Colombo yesterday.


Disabled soldiers in action in the 100 metres relay event yesterday

They bagged 450 points while the Gajaba Regiment were the runner up with 260 points. Vijayaba Infantry Regiment were placed third with 194 points. Sri Lanka’s renowned wheelchair Tennis player Singhe Regiment’s Upali Rajakaruna was adjudged the best sportsman in the meet.

There were thirteen events worked off at venues around the island as a part of the meet during the months of June, July and August and over 750 sportsmen took part in the meet which inaugurated in 1991.

The meet has also produced some of the athletes who emerged champions at several international meets over the past years too.

The chief guest of the closing ceremony Defence Secretary Gotabhaya Rajapaksa said that Rajakaruna is a fine example for everyone. “Measures have been taken to uplift the conditions of the disabled soldiers and the government will continue to look after them” said the Defence Secretary.

Army Commander Lieutenant General Jagath Jayasuriya was also present at the closing ceremony.

Best Athletes:

Class 01: Wheelchair: K Weerasinghe (Infantry Regiment)

Class 02: Wheelchair: Cpl Madurawa (Infantry Regiment)

Class 03: Above Knee Amputee: Priyankara (Infantry Regiment)

Class 04: Below Knee Amputee:Udaya Pushpakumara (Vijayaba )

Class 05: Both Arms Amputee: Herath (Gemunu)

Class 06: Arm Amputee: Y G S Weerasinghe

Class 07: Totally Blind: Weerasinghe(CDO)

Class 08: Partially Blind: Saman Kumara (Gajaba), H M Herath (Gamunu)

Class 09: One eye Blind: Ekanayake (Vijayaba)

Class 10: Deaf: Sanjeewa (Vijayaba)

Championship Trophies:

Table Tennis: Vijayaba Infantry Regiment

Badminton: Gajaba Regiment

Cricket: Vijayaba Infantry Regiment

Power lifting: Sinha Regiment

Archery: Sri Lanka Infantry Regiment

Swimming: Gajaba Regiment

Volleyball: Sri Lanka Infrantry Regiment.

Air Riffle: Sri Lanka Infantry Regiment.

Wheelchair Basketball: Gajaba Regiment

Wheelchair Tennis: Sinha Regiment

Athletics: Sri Lanka Infrantry Regiment.

Best Sportsman: Rajakaruna (Sinha regiment)

Third place: Vijayaba Infantry Regiment - 194 points

Runner-up: Gajaba Regiment - 260 points

Champions: Sri Lanka Infantry Regiment - 450 points
